Leo Cancer Care raises $65M to expand upright radiotherapy and imaging production
Radiology Business2d ago
Leo Cancer Care has secured $65 million in funding to scale manufacturing of its upright radiology solutions, including proton therapy, photon therapy, and imaging systems.
- The funding will support scaling production of upright patient positioning and imaging devices for proton and photon therapy.
- The company's solutions aim to integrate imaging and treatment in a vertical orientation, potentially reducing footprint and cost.
- No specific clinical trial data or regulatory milestones were disclosed in the announcement.
